Skip to content

Setting Up and Publishing a Chat Application Using Kotlin

Setting Up and Publishing a Chat Application Using Kotlin is a free online course by Alison US CA that teaches Kotlin-based Android chat app development. It covers project setup, UI design, login systems, avatars, navigation drawers, and secure web requests. Ideal for aspiring Android developers wanting hands-on experience building real-time communication apps at no cost.

● In stock

Buy at Alison →

Price and availability may change. Click to see current details on Alison.

Key features

  • Free online Kotlin tutorial
  • Step-by-step Android Studio setup
  • Login activity implementation
  • Dynamic avatar generation
  • Navigation drawer integration
  • HTTP and API fundamentals
  • Real-time chat app focus

Pros

  • +Completely free to access
  • +Hands-on project-based learning
  • +Covers essential Android components
!

Cons

  • No official certification
  • Limited advanced backend coverage

About Setting Up and Publishing a Chat Application Using Kotlin

What is Setting Up and Publishing a Chat Application Using Kotlin?

Setting Up and Publishing a Chat Application Using Kotlin is a free online programming course offered by Alison US CA. Designed for aspiring Android developers, this tutorial provides step-by-step guidance on building a real-time chat application using Kotlin, the preferred language for modern Android development. The course walks learners through setting up a project in Android Studio, designing the main activity UI, implementing a login system, generating user avatars and background colors, and integrating a navigation drawer for seamless app navigation.

Key features

  • Free Access — No cost to enroll or complete the course.
  • Project Setup Guidance — Learn to configure Android Studio for Kotlin development.
  • UI Development — Build intuitive interfaces including login and main activity screens.
  • Avatar and Color Generation — Implement dynamic user profile visuals.
  • Navigation Drawer Integration — Add standard Android navigation patterns.
  • Web Requests and APIs — Understand HTTP communication and API security fundamentals.
  • Real-Time App Focus — Emphasis on chat functionality and user interaction.

Who is Setting Up and Publishing a Chat Application Using Kotlin for?

This course is ideal for beginner to intermediate developers interested in Android app development using Kotlin. It suits students, career changers, or hobbyists seeking practical experience in building real-time communication apps. No prior Kotlin expertise is required, but basic programming knowledge enhances learning outcomes. It's especially valuable for those aiming to add chat functionality to their portfolio projects.

How does Setting Up and Publishing a Chat Application Using Kotlin compare?

Unlike paid coding bootcamps or dense university curricula, this free Alison course delivers focused, project-based learning on chat app development. Compared to general Kotlin tutorials, it emphasizes practical implementation of real-time features, UI components, and secure web requests. While it doesn't offer certifications with industry recognition like some premium platforms, it provides accessible, hands-on training comparable to introductory modules in more expensive programs, making it a strong entry point for budget-conscious learners.

🎯

Best use cases

  • Learning Kotlin for Android apps
  • Building a chat app portfolio piece
  • Understanding HTTP and APIs
  • Implementing UI navigation patterns
  • Creating dynamic user interfaces
🛒

Is Setting Up and Publishing a Chat Application Using Kotlin right for you?

This free course is best for beginners or intermediate developers learning Android development with Kotlin. No purchase is required—just sign up on Alison US CA. Ideal for those building real-time apps or expanding UI and API skills. Alternatives include paid Udemy courses or Google's Android Developer Path, but this offers a no-cost entry point with practical focus.

How it compares: Compared to standard polypropylene rugs, this chat app course offers digital skill development instead of physical home decor. It serves educational needs rather than functional flooring, targeting developers over homeowners.

More from Alison

?

Frequently Asked Questions

What is the course about?

This course teaches how to build a real-time Android chat app using Kotlin in Android Studio. You'll learn project setup, UI design, login systems, avatars, navigation drawers, and how to handle web requests and APIs securely.

Does the course cost money?

No, the course is completely free. Alison US CA offers it at no charge, with no hidden fees for accessing the core content or completing the tutorial.

How long does it take to finish?

The course typically takes 3-5 hours to complete, depending on your pace and prior experience with Android development and Kotlin programming.

Is a certificate provided?

Yes, Alison provides a free digital certificate upon completion, though it may not carry the same weight as industry-recognized credentials.

Can I publish my app after this course?

Yes, the course guides you through publishing steps. You'll learn how to prepare your Kotlin chat app for release on platforms like the Google Play Store.

Is Setting Up and Publishing a Chat Application Using Kotlin in stock at Alison?

Yes, Setting Up and Publishing a Chat Application Using Kotlin is currently in stock at Alison.

Specifications

Category
Software
SKU
3904
Last updated May 14, 2026